June 19, 1865. Galveston, Texas. A Union general rides in with news that should have arrived two and a half years earlier: you are free. The people who heard those words wept, ran, dropped to their knees in the dirt, and celebrated so hard the echo has never stopped.
That is Juneteenth. Not just a holiday on a calendar — but a living reminder that freedom, once promised, must be fully delivered. That joy, even when it arrives late, is still worth celebrating with everything you have.
